Scanning Multiple Pages of Originals as One File

This section explains the procedure for sending multiple originals as a multi-page file or storing them as a
single stored file.
• To send multiple originals as a multi-page file, in [Send File Type / Name], select a multi-page file
type. For details about file types, see "Specifying the File Type".
1.
Press [Original Feed Type].
2.
Select [Batch] or [SADF].
To scan originals using the exposure glass, select [Batch]. To scan originals using the ADF, select
[SADF]. For detail about [Batch] and [SADF], see "Batch, SADF".
6
3.
Press [OK].
4.
Place originals.
5.
Make settings for sending or storing.
6.
Press the [Start] key to scan originals.
If [Batch] is selected, place additional originals, and then press the [Start] key.
If [SADF] is selected, scanning starts automatically when you place additional originals. Place
subsequent originals after the originals have been scanned.
Repeat this step until all originals are scanned.
7.
After all originals are scanned, press the [ ] key.
Storing or transmission starts.
• If [Batch] is selected, originals can be scanned using the ADF.
• When scanning originals using the exposure glass, depending on the settings for [Wait Time for
Next Orig.: Exposure Glass] under [Scanner Features], the machine can wait for additional
originals even if [Batch] is not selected in [Original Feed Type]. For details about [Wait Time for
Next Orig.: Exposure Glass], see "Scan Settings".
